Pular para conteúdo

HTML

HTML, sigla para Hyper Text Markup Language, é uma linguagem de marcação utilizada para criar e estruturar conteúdo na web. É a base de construção de qualquer site ou aplicação web.

O HTML permite que os desenvolvedores criem elementos como textos, imagens, vídeos, formulários e links, e os organize de forma a tornar o conteúdo compreensível e acessível aos usuários.

Exemplos de uso

A seguir, alguns exemplos de como o HTML é utilizado na criação de páginas web:

Texto:

<p>Este é um parágrafo.</p>
<h1>Título</h1>
<h2>Subtítulo</h2>

Imagens:

<img src="imagem.jpg" alt="Descrição da imagem" />

Vídeos:

<video controls>
  <source src="video.mp4" type="video/mp4" />
  <source src="video.webm" type="video/webm" />
  Seu navegador não suporta o elemento de vídeo.
</video>

Formulários:

<form>
  <label for="nome">Nome:</label>
  <input type="text" id="nome" name="nome" />

  <label for="email">E-mail:</label>
  <input type="email" id="email" name="email" />

  <label for="mensagem">Mensagem:</label>
  <textarea id="mensagem" name="mensagem"></textarea>

  <input type="submit" value="Enviar" />
</form>

Links:

<a href="https://www.exemplo.com">Exemplo</a>

Vantagens e desvantagens

Algumas vantagens de utilizar HTML para desenvolver páginas web são:

  • Fácil aprendizado e utilização;
  • Compatibilidade com diversos navegadores;
  • Estrutura clara e organizada para o conteúdo.

No entanto, há também algumas desvantagens:

  • Limitações na criação de layouts complexos;
  • Dificuldades para adicionar interatividade à página;
  • Dificuldades em manter a consistência visual entre diferentes páginas do site.

Conclusão

O HTML é uma das principais tecnologias utilizadas no desenvolvimento de páginas web, permitindo que os desenvolvedores estruturem e organizem o conteúdo para torná-lo compreensível e acessível aos usuários. Embora tenha algumas limitações, o HTML ainda é essencial para a criação de qualquer site ou aplicação web.

comments powered by Disqus

Veja também:

Bootstrap

Framework baseado em HTML, CSS e JavaScript